Acharya Prashant addresses the common human tendency to worry about negative outcomes, explaining that simply trying to replace negative thoughts with positive ones does not solve the underlying issue because the focus remains on the result. He suggests that there are two states in which a person stops being troubled by outcomes: the state of knowledge and the state of love. In the state of knowledge, one acts out of a sense of duty or righteousness, understanding that a particular action must be performed regardless of the consequences. This sense of duty is described as one's true religion or 'Dharma', where the mind stops calculating gains and losses because the action itself is seen as necessary.
